Table of Contents
Audio authentication models are increasingly vital in security systems, voice assistants, and digital identity verification. These models rely heavily on large datasets to accurately distinguish between genuine and fraudulent audio samples. However, collecting extensive audio data can be challenging and resource-intensive.
Understanding Data Augmentation
Data augmentation involves artificially increasing the size and diversity of training datasets by applying various transformations to existing audio samples. This technique helps models generalize better to real-world variations and improves their robustness.
Common Audio Augmentation Techniques
- Noise Addition: Incorporating background noises to simulate real environments.
- Time Shifting: Slightly shifting audio signals in time to mimic variations in speech timing.
- Pitch Alteration: Changing the pitch to account for different voice tones.
- Speed Variation: Modifying playback speed to simulate different speaking rates.
- Volume Adjustment: Varying loudness levels to reflect different recording conditions.
Benefits of Data Augmentation
Implementing data augmentation in training audio authentication models offers several advantages:
- Improved Generalization: Models become better at handling unseen audio variations.
- Reduced Overfitting: Augmentation prevents the model from memorizing training data.
- Enhanced Robustness: Increased resilience to background noise and recording inconsistencies.
- Cost-Effective Data Expansion: Generates diverse data without extensive new recordings.
Challenges and Considerations
While data augmentation offers many benefits, it also presents challenges. Over-augmentation can introduce unrealistic audio samples, potentially confusing the model. It is essential to balance augmentation techniques to maintain data quality. Additionally, some transformations may require domain-specific tuning to be effective.
Conclusion
Data augmentation plays a crucial role in enhancing the performance of audio authentication models. By artificially expanding datasets with realistic variations, developers can create more accurate, robust, and reliable systems. As audio technology advances, effective augmentation strategies will remain vital for secure and efficient voice-based applications.